No. 2651 A BILL TO BE ENTITLED 1-1 AN ACT 1-2 relating to pollutant source reduction and waste minimization. 1-3 B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S: 1-4 SECTION 1. Section 361.505, Health and Safety Code, is 1-5 amended by adding Subsection (f) to read as follows: 1-6 (f) A person may include recycling, reuse, treatment, or 1-7 disposal activities in the waste minimization portion of the plan 1-8 in place of other source reduction or waste minimization activities 1-9 if recycling, reuse, treatment, or disposal produces a more 1-10 advantageous cost-benefit ratio in accomplishing the goals and 1-11 policies of this subchapter. This subsection does not alter or 1-12 replace the requirements of Subsection (a) of this section, but is 1-13 intended to create an additional option such as those contained in 1-14 Subsection (b) of this section. 1-15 SECTION 2. This Act takes effect September 1, 1995. 1-16 SECTION 3.
